#eb0f6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b0f6c is composed of 92.2% red, 5.9%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 54%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 334.6 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 49%. #eb0f6c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ed8 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#eb0f6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b0f6c has RGB values of R:235, G:15,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.54,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15404908.

Shades and Tints of #eb0f6c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0106 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#eb0f6c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81797c is the less saturated color, while #f5056b is the most saturated one.
